Real face Atletico in Champions League Madrid derby

The Champions League Round of 16 stage kicks off this week with Real Madrid taking on cross-city rivals Atletico Madrid in arguably the tie of the round.

Carlo Ancelotti's side are looking to go through against Diego Simeone's team in what is all but guaranteed to be a classic on and off the pitch.

We've seen 9 Madrid derby matches in the Champions League over the years with the most famous meeting coming in the 2014 final.

Real beat Atletico 4-1 eventually after needing a 93rd minute equaliser from Sergio Ramos to send the game into extra time and put them on the way to La Decima.

Bayern take on Leverkusen in all-German battle

Bayern Munich and Bayer Leverkusen are set to clash in an all-German Champions League Round of 16 tie, with the first leg taking place at the Allianz Arena on Wednesday. 

This is the first time these two Bundesliga giants meet in a major European competition, making it a highly anticipated encounter.

Bayern, led by Harry Kane, are looking to get one over on Leverkusen with Xabi Alonso's team having great recent history in this fixture.

Aston Villa, Arsenal and Liverpool remaining English teams

England will be represented by three Premier League sides after Manchester City were knocked out by Real Madrid in the play-off stage.

Aston Villa go up against Club Brugge again looking to get revenge for their 1-0 defeat away against the Belgian side back in November.

Liverpool will face PSG in what will be a tricky tie with the French side flying this season with fantastic form shown.

Arsenal take on PSV Eindhoven in what could also be a tough match after the Dutch team knocked out Italian giants Juventus in the play-offs.
